,
- Thursday, November 14, 2024
Florida Shops
- Florida(443)
- -> (1412)
- -> Hollywood(6)
- -> Off Track Bike Shop
Off Track Bike Shop
Florida - - Hollywood
6333 Miramar Parkway,
Hollywood
Phone: (954) 894-5700
Website:
Hours:
Services:
Products:
Find us on Yelp!